nix/meta: keep concrete nixpkgs.url per mara on #619

mara on #619 comment 7354:
> agent flake needs the url actually so the configuring agent
> can eval against it

Reverts the meta.rs `nixpkgs.follows = "hyperhive/nixpkgs"` shape from
this PR's earlier commit. Restores the pre-PR rendered shape with the
concrete `nixpkgs.url = "github:NixOS/nixpkgs/nixos-26.05"` baked
into meta + the `hyperhive.inputs.nixpkgs.follows = "nixpkgs"`
redirect, so a configuring agent (or manager pre-apply check) can
evaluate the rendered meta flake without having to resolve through
hyperhive first.

Net behaviour for this PR is now:
- `flake.nix` line 5 bumped 25.11 → 26.05 (kept)
- `meta.rs` literal bumped to match (channel-pin in two places stays
  acknowledged as duplication — drift fixable later if needed)
- `flake_check.rs` test fixtures bumped cosmetically (kept)
- meta.rs tests restored to assert the concrete-URL shape

3 meta tests pass via `nix develop -c cargo test`.
